Picture of SLIM STICK The Slim Stick is a straight cane designed for use by individuals with walking or balance disabilities. This cane has a carbon fiber shaft, an aluminum knob handle, and a rubber traction tip with steel insert. A removable wrist strap is included. OPTIONS: Combi tip with ice tip and cane holder. DIMENSIONS: 39 inches long (can be cut to size). The knob handle is 1.5 inches in diameter. CAPACITY: 250 pounds. WEIGHT: 6.7 ounces. COLOR: Black with silver shaft and silver anodized aluminum handle.
